I purchased this from my Remington 870. It is a nice red dot sight. The 10 position brightness allows me to see the dot in any light conditions.
The only complaints I have is that because of the location of the dial I had to take off my iron sight before mounting.
I find that the low profile, while good for accuracy, is too low for me to get a comfortable aim.
While I am happy with it for the price I might have been better server spending more money and getting something on a higher mount.
Pros: Bright dot, long battery life
Cons: Dial location

I have this mounted on my WASR-10 and after a trip to the range, I must say that I'm pleased. It's secured to a UTG quad-rail and doesn't add much weight to the front of the rifle. There is a small gap between the end of the rail and the rear peep sights and it allows you to replace the battery without removing the optic itself. I'm not sure why ATN thought that it was a good idea to place the battery compartment there but there are ways around it. I'm a former Marine Corp Rifleman and I must admit, my AK is not as accurate as what I am used to with an A4, but with this it was pretty close. I really like the circle and dot reticle the most and the zero stayed the same on all of the settings. I wouldn't take this to war though, maybe because I was spoiled with that ACOG....You'd have to expect a noticeable difference between an $80 red dot and something from Trijicon but it's pretty solid. There is ALOT of glare with this thing, even on an indoor range that was pretty dim. All in all it's solid for the range or to experiment to figure out whether or not you'll like a red dot or prefer a traditional scope. I'll eventually update to a PK-AS now that I know that I'm comfortable with red dots.
Pros: Easy to mount, light-weight , and attractive. It's a good entry-level sight.
Cons: Why would you make it so you'd have to remove the optic to replace the battery? WHY? WHY again?
